快速下载

下载 openclaw

openclaw 设置优化与稳定性建议 202604:新手避坑与性能调优指南

功能介绍
openclaw 设置优化与稳定性建议 202604:新手避坑与性能调优指南

针对 2026 年 4 月更新的 openclaw 环境,本指南深度解析了从首次安装到跨环境迁移的核心设置逻辑。我们不仅涵盖了基础的参数配置,还针对新手用户常遇到的高并发崩溃、连接超时等稳定性痛点,提供了基于 v2.8.4 版本的实战优化方案。通过调整核心心跳频率与内存回收阈值,用户可有效提升系统在高负载下的运行表现。无论您是刚接触 openclaw 的初学者,还是正在寻求生产环境迁移建议的技术人员,本文提供的排障细节与参数参考都将助您快速构建稳健的自动化工作流。

在 2026 年 4 月的技术生态下,openclaw 已演进至 v2.8.4 版本。对于新手而言,如何从零开始完成一套既能快速上手又能长期稳定运行的配置,是提升工作效率的关键。本文将跳过冗长的理论,直接进入实战参数调优与故障排查环节。

环境初始化:规避首次配置的“隐形坑”

在安装 openclaw 后的首次配置中,新手最易忽略的是系统路径权限与依赖库的完整性。建议在 Windows 环境下强制使用管理员模式运行初始化脚本,而在 Linux 环境下,务必检查 `/var/lib/openclaw` 目录的写入权限。针对 202604 批次的新版本,官方引入了动态环境检测机制。若在配置过程中遇到“Dependency mismatch”报错,请优先检查 Python 运行库是否低于 3.12 版本。一个实战细节是:在 `config.yaml` 中,将 `auto_repair_deps` 参数设为 `true`,系统会在启动时自动校验并补齐缺失的动态链接库,这能减少 80% 以上的启动失败案例。

openclaw相关配图

稳定性调优:解决高并发下的内存溢出

当 openclaw 运行超过 48 小时或处理大规模任务时,稳定性往往受限于内存管理。在 v2.8.4 版本中,我们建议将 `max_retry_count` 设置为 5,并将 `heartbeat_interval` 调整为 30s。针对真实场景中的内存泄漏问题(常见于频繁抓取动态内容的任务),可以通过设置 `gc_threshold` 参数来强制执行垃圾回收。具体操作是在优化选项卡中开启“低内存模式”,这会将单进程的内存占用限制在 512MB 以内。如果您的硬件配置较高,建议采用多实例部署而非单实例超高线程,这样即使某个实例因异常崩溃,也不会影响整体任务的连续性。

openclaw相关配图

迁移实战:从本地开发环境到云端部署

许多用户在将 openclaw 从本地机器迁移到云服务器(如阿里云或 AWS)时,会遇到连接超时或 API 握手失败的问题。这通常是因为云端的 MTU 值或防火墙策略与本地不一致。排查细节:请检查云安全组是否放行了 openclaw 默认的 8848 通讯端口。在迁移配置文件时,严禁直接复制 `runtime.db` 文件,而应使用内置的 `export_config` 命令导出 JSON 格式配置。在云端运行 202604 更新包时,建议在启动参数中加入 `--dns-resolve-mode=remote`,以避开某些内网环境下的 DNS 污染,确保抓取节点能够稳定解析目标域名。

openclaw相关配图

版本更新与回滚:确保业务不中断

2026 年 4 月的更新包含多个核心组件的重构,因此在点击“一键更新”前,务必手动备份 `storage` 文件夹。若更新后发现自定义插件失效,通常是由于新版本的 API 鉴权逻辑变更。此时,可以通过修改 `security_level` 参数为 `legacy` 来临时恢复兼容性。对于追求极致稳定的生产环境,建议采用“蓝绿部署”策略:先在测试端口运行新版本,确认 `error.log` 中无持续的 `SocketException` 后,再切换主流量。记住,v2.8.4 版本的核心优势在于其自愈能力,确保 `self_healing_enabled` 处于开启状态是维持全年 99.9% 可用性的基础。

常见问题

为什么在 202604 版本更新后,任务启动速度变慢了?

这通常是因为新版本增强了预加载校验。请检查 `pre_scan_level` 设置,将其从 `deep` 改为 `fast` 即可恢复启动速度,但这会略微降低对损坏配置文件的拦截率。

遇到‘Database is locked’报错该如何彻底解决?

这是由于高频写入导致的 SQLite 锁死。请在设置中将 `write_mode` 更改为 `WAL` (Write-Ahead Logging),并确保 openclaw 运行在 SSD 硬盘上以降低 I/O 延迟。

如何确认我的 openclaw 已经处于最佳优化状态?

运行内置的性能诊断工具(命令:`openclaw --bench`)。如果‘Stability Score’高于 90 分且‘Latency’波动小于 15%,则说明当前的参数配置已完美适配您的硬件环境。

总结

立即前往 openclaw 官方下载频道获取 v2.8.4 稳定版镜像,并下载完整的《2026 稳定性优化白皮书》。

相关阅读:openclaw 设置优化与稳定性建议 202604openclaw 设置优化与稳定性建议 202604使用技巧掌握 openclaw 202614 周效率实践清单:从零配置到自动化迁移全指南

openclaw 设置优化与稳定性建议 202604 openclaw